Responsibilities

  • Manage and oversee all aspects of pre-contract and post-contract quantity surveying activities.
  • Prepare detailed cost estimates and conduct rigorous cost planning for construction projects.
  • Lead the preparation, analysis, and negotiation of tenders and contracts with clients and contractors.
  • Monitor project expenditures and ensure effective cost control throughout project lifecycles.
  • Conduct risk assessment and management to mitigate potential financial discrepancies and hazards.
  • Develop detailed project documentation, including cost reports, contracts, and progress reports.
  • Liaise with project managers to ensure cost-effective project completion within agreed budgets and timelines.
  • Evaluate and track changes to project design and construction work, adjusting budgets as necessary.
  • Foster strong relationships with external contractors, suppliers, and clients to facilitate successful project outcomes.
  • Oversee the resolution of disputes and claims, employing negotiation and problem-solving skills.
  • Guide and mentor junior surveyors, providing technical assistance and professional development support.
  • Ensure compliance with industry standards, legal requirements, and safety regulations in all surveying tasks.
